Grandview and Cherokee Trail both had their chances at winning the Class 5A boys state track & field championship at Jefferson County Stadium, but Fountain-Fort Carson nipped both at the finish line.
By just two points, the Wolves had the program’s first state team championship snatched away when the 4×400 meter relay concluded May 17. Before the final event, senior JR Smith, junior Triston Sisneros and a handful of others had moved up from their projected finishes to put Grandview in championship position.
But Fountain-Fort Carson managed to top the Wolves in the final relay to take the title.
Cherokee Trail, meanwhile, finished six points out of the top spot, but would have had a chance to win the title if not for a dropped baton in the 4×400 meter relay prelims. The Cougars had the state’s top time in the event coming into state before the disqualification and could have won the team title.
Senior Brandon Singleton raced to individual state championships in the 200 and 400 meters and Mar’Keith Bailey came in second in the 400 as Cherokee Trail closed strong.
Smoky Hill’s Blake Yount, the Colorado State record-holder in the 800 meters, lost the event by just 0.02 of a second to Denver East star Cerake Geberkidane, while Regis Jesuit’s John Schmidt posted top-three finishes in both sprint events.
Cherokee Trail had Aurora’s best team finish with an eighth-place result, while some excellent relay performances pushed Eaglecrest to 13th and freshman Michaela Onyenwere’s big state debut helped Grandview tie for 14th.
Eaglecrest’s Tashay Brown, Tori Coombe, Omotumininu Olatiopo and Alicia Taurchini won the 800 meter sprint medley relay for Aurora’s lone championship on the girls side.
